I got the shades Fruit Punch and Hunk. When I first got hold of these lipsticks, the weather in MNL was very humid and hot back then. I even thought that these lipstick were on the verge of a meltdown because when I swatched them at the back of my hand these lipsticks felt like breaking. Good thing I did not give them away because these are very nice lipsticks!! They are a hybrid of a lipstick and balm. They looked like tinted lipbalms on my lips! They feel so light and moisturizing. They give off a glossy finish or healthy sheen on the lips. The texture is creamy and buttery. The color pay off is surprisingly good. Most glossy lipsticks do not work on my dark lips but with these lipsticks, I can wear them on their own without any lip liners. Also, these lipsticks lasted a good three hours on my lips without retouch but sans eating/drinking. However, despite not lasting on the lips that much these lippies leave a nice pink stain the lips. These lippies do not have any scent. My only problem with these butter lipsticks is the fact that they do not work well with dry chapping lips. Because they are glossy and hydrating, they have the tendency to emphasize dryness and flaking.
I was surprised that both shades are wearable for everyday wear. Fruit Punch is a bright coral fuchsia pink while Hunk is a purplish hot pink. I also got this NYX Illuminator in the shade Chaotic. This is a nice light peachy pink shade with gold sparkles. It delivers a very beautiful glow on the skin but it does not look like a highlighter on my skin. Instead, it looks like a light blush with sheen. The color is very subtle and glowing but does not lasts long on my cheeks. On fairer skin, this illuminator will definitely show up as a blush.
The product itself is smooth and blendable. Despite having sparkles it does not feel gritty at all.
